vāyuḥ

  • wind
  • air
  • the wind
  • the god of wind

In 5 verses

Chapter 1 5 of 18 chapters Chapter 18
  1. 2.67

    इन्द्रियाणां हि चरतां यन्मनोऽनुविधीयते

    vāyuḥ — wind

    As a boat on water is carried off by the wind, so a mind that follows the wandering senses carries off the understanding.

  2. 7.4

    भूमिरापोऽनलो वायुः खं मनो बुद्धिरेव च

    vāyuḥ — air

    Earth, water, fire, air, space, mind, understanding and the sense of self — these are the eight divisions of my lower nature.

  3. 9.6

    यथाऽऽकाशस्थितो नित्यं वायुः सर्वत्रगो महान्

    vāyuḥ — the wind

    As the great wind, blowing everywhere, rests in space — so all beings rest in me. Understand it that way.

  4. 11.39

    वायुर्यमोऽग्निर्वरुणः शशाङ्कः प्रजापतिस्त्वं प्रपितामहश्च

    vāyuḥ — the god of wind

    You are the wind, death, fire, the waters, the moon, the lord of creatures, and the great-grandfather. I bow to you a thousand times, and again, and again I bow.

  5. 15.8

    शरीरं यदवाप्नोति यच्चाप्युत्क्रामतीश्वरः

    vāyuḥ — the air

    When the lord of the body takes a body, and when he leaves it, he carries these with him — as the wind carries scents from their places.
